Aqueous glyoxal: a versatile synthon in heterocyclic synthesis

Abstract

This review highlights the applications of aqueous glyoxal as a versatile reagent in organic synthesis, with a focus on protocols for generating diverse molecular frameworks, including five- and six-membered heterocycles.
